The Nigeria Union of Teachers (NUT) is to hold a National Executive Council (NEC) meeting on Thursday to decide its next line of action over the lingering strike by university teachers. The NUT President, Mr. Michael Alogba-Olukoya, said this in a telephone chat with the News Agency of Nigeria (NAN) in Lagos on Tuesday. The union had on September 26 given a two-week ultimatum to the Federal Government and the lecturers to resolve their differences and end the strike or face nationwide strike by NUT members. The lecturers under the aegis of the Academic Staff Union of Universities (ASUU) embarked on the nationwide strike on July 1. The lecturers described the strike as “comprehensive, total and indefinite.” Alogba-Olukoya told NAN that the union extended the ultimatum following appeals from well-meaning Nigerians. He, however, noted that the extension would end on Tuesday. “Since we gave the ultimatum, well meaning Nigerians have been pleading with us. “In order not to cry more than the bereaved, we gave them till October 22. The NEC members will meet on Thursday to decide our next line of action, “he said. For close to two hours, Monday afternoon, Facebook users were having difficulties in updating their status, post pictures and the like. Attempts by users to update on the social networking site yielded this message: “There was a problem updating your status. Please try again in a few minutes.” The peculiar bug was partially fixed after a couple of hours as some are able to operate their accounts accurately – many still face difficulties. The development raised dust among users most of whom initially thought the issue was not a common problem. Consequently, Iain Mackenzie, the European communications director for Facebook, confirmed the issue on twitter : “We are aware that some people are having problems posting to Facebook and we’re looking into it.” According to Michael Allen, Director of APM, Compuware, the outage would potentially affect “billions of people.” “If you look at the Outage Analyser service, at least 3,587 other domains were impacted; although the actual number is likely to be far greater. This is because many other businesses and websites are connected to Facebook. For example, Facebook is used to enable people to log in to many other sites and applications. Any organisation that is seeing errors or slowdowns with their own site or application this afternoon, should check to see if they are relying on Facebook services before they start fire fighting as this might be the cause. A mobile policeman attached to the Special Task Force in Jos shot and killed his colleague on Saturday. Two other people were also said to have been injured in the shooting, which occurred in the early hours of Saturday in Jol, Riyom Local Government Area of Plateau State. The injured people, who had not been identified as at the time of this report, were said to be on danger list at Vom Christian Hospital, near Jos. The Executive Director of Stefanos Foundation, Mr. Mark Lipdo, told our correspondent that they had yet to understand the motive of the shooting. Plateau State Police Commissioner, Mr. Chris Olakpe, told our correspondent that investigations were on to ascertain the cause of the incident. He said, “I am right now addressing the men to calm them down so that the incident will not dampen their spirit. We will not like anything that will affect their morale, especially at this time we are preparing for a crucial task of the local government elections in the state. President Goodluck Jonathan has pleaded with the striking members of the Academic Staff Union of Universities (ASUU) to call-off their four-month old industrial action. Jonathan made the plea while commissioning the Faculty of Engineering Complex building of Afe Babalola University, Ado-Ekiti yesterday. Jonathan urged ASUU members to review their industrial action and go back to class. The president said his regime was working assiduously to meet the lecturers’ demands. Jonathan, who was the special guest of honor at the first convocation ceremony at the University, acknowledged that the country is facing a lot of challenges, assuring that his government was poised to solving the problem confronting the education sector. ”Even to those of us holding political offices, those in the health sector, the police, the army, the Department of State Service(DSS), the thinking out there is that we are operating in the best environment. This is not true. ’If we all decide to embark on long strike ,definitely, we will all ground the nation.” The president reasoned that if ASUU members have genuine and patriotic mind towards pressing home their demands, four months was enough in achieving this. ”I urge every patriotic Nigerian to plead with ASUU to suspend their strike action and resume class. L-R: Ekiti State Governor, Dr Kayode Fayemi; Vice Chancellor, Afe Babalola University, ABUAD, Prof. Sidi Osho; founder, ABUAD, Aare Afe Babalola; President Goodluck Jonathan; and wife of the founder, ABUAD, Mrs. Modupe Babalola, at the Commissioning of the Ultra-Modern Engineering Faculty Building of the University, in Ado-Ekiti… on Saturday. ”I promise to work with all Nigerians,what ever inadequacies we have with education,we are seriously working towards solving it. ”ASUU should temper their anger with patriotism. ”Long strike will definitely ground our educational sector. ”If you are talking to government and government is not listening, or government is not cooperating with you, that is a different thing entirely. The president promised that his government was steadily trying to solve the problems confronting other sectors of the economy ,including education by providing infrastructural facilities. He commended the founder of Afe Babalola University for establishing a first class privately owned university. On the demand of the state government on the establishment of airport and federal secretariat, Jonathan said N400million had been earmarked in this year’s budget for the airport. Speaking earlier, Ekiti State Governor, Kayode Fayemi, made a plea on the establishment of an airport in the state. Fayemi noted that the state government had paid part of the N320million counterpart funding for the establishment of the airport. The governor noted that Ekiti was the only state out of those created in 1996 that is yet to have a federal secretariat. He disclosed that Ekiti was yet to be fully reimbursed on the N13billion spent on the construction of federal roads in the state, noting that only N2billion was paid to the state by the Federal Government. Speaking earlier,the founder of the university, Are Afe Babalola(SAN) said he decided to establish the N60billion university because of his love and concern for qualitative education. Babalola claimed that the institution was rated as the second best private university and number 16 in the country, saying his motive was to provide a world class university. He appealed to the Federal Government to come to the assistance of private universities in the country, especially in the area of research. Plea to PHCN workers Meanwhile, the President has urged workers of recently privatised PHCN to shelve their plan to go on strike on the grounds of non-payment of their entitlements. According to him, efforts were on to pay the entitlements. Jonathan also assured Nigerians that electricity supply will reasonably stabilise before the middle of next year. He spoke while commissioning the National Integrated Power Project NIPP 500MW Omotosho Phase II power station in Okitipupa council area of Ondo State. The commissioning of the Omotosho NIPP is coming 16 days after that of Geregu power station. Jonathan said Nigerians should appreciate the efforts of his administration in transforming the power sector. ” I am not saying that electricity supply will be total but I want to assure that light will be reasonably stabilised before the middle of next year,” the President said. According to him, by the time his administration is through with transformation in the power sector, the results will be likened to the reforms in the banking and telecommunication sectors. The President pointed out that all the ten NIPP which will add 4700MW to the national grid, will be completed by the end of first quarter of next year and be privatised. He commended Governor Olusegun Mimiko of Ondo State, traditional rulers, and youths in the community for their supportive role in the realisation of the project. Earlier, Mimiko said the project will only have meaningful impact when transmission projects are completed. According to Mimiko, the state will soon complete and invite the President to come and commission a 30MW power station in Omotosho which was initiated by his administration. He commended the untiring efforts of Jonathan in transforming infrastructure in the country, noting that posterity will judge him positively. Minister of Power, Prof. Chinedu Nebo, lauded the political will of the President in effecting change not only in the power sector but also in all the sectors. The Saudi authorities on Saturday in Makkah said over 1.3 million pilgrims from around the world would perform this year’s Hajj rites at Arafat on Monday. A Saudi official, Marwan Zubaidi, told the News Agency of Nigeria in Makkah that pilgrims’ transportation to Mina on the way to Arafat would begin on Saturday night. Zubaid said the “ascending and descending” committee had concluded all arrangements to ease the movement of pilgrims to the Holy sites, as directed by the Hajj Minister, Bandar Hajjar. Zubaidi assured pilgrims that adequate arrangements had been made for those who would want to spend the night at Mina to do so without hassle. The official, who is the Secretary of the General Car Syndicate (NAQABA), said buses and guides had been deployed to the various camps in Makkah to ease movement to Mina. “Special shuttle bus services have also been provided for 563,000 pilgrims from Europe, Eastern Asia, non-Arab Africa and Iran,” he said. Zubaidi also said regular bus services would be available for 750,000 Southern Asia and Arab pilgrims.
